We are working with a leading new build housing developer seeking an experienced Site Manager to oversee the delivery of residential projects in Stoke.
Key Responsibilities:
- Manage, coordinate, and oversee the entire project, including operatives, subcontractors, and materials, ensuring timely completion.
- Monitor team performance for both direct employees and subcontractors, ensuring work is completed to high standards.
- Ensure site safety by adhering to health and safety regulations and best practices.
Requirements:
- SMSTS (Site Management Safety Training Scheme)
- First Aid Certification
- CSCS Card
- Previous experience managing new build housing projects
